+{
+ self,
+ home-manager,
+ nixosTest,
+}:
+
+nixosTest {
+ name = "fortify-test";
+
+ # adapted from nixos sway integration tests
+
+ # testScriptWithTypes:49: error: Cannot call function of unknown type
+ # (machine.succeed if succeed else machine.execute)(
+ # ^
+ # Found 1 error in 1 file (checked 1 source file)
+ skipTypeCheck = true;
+
+ nodes.machine =
+ { lib, pkgs, ... }:
+ {
+ users.users.alice = {
+ isNormalUser = true;
+ description = "Alice Foobar";
+ password = "foobar";
+ uid = 1000;
+ };
+
+ home-manager.users.alice.home.stateVersion = "24.11";
+
+ # Automatically login on tty1 as a normal user:
+ services.getty.autologinUser = "alice";
+
+ environment = {
+ variables = {
+ SWAYSOCK = "/tmp/sway-ipc.sock";
+ WLR_RENDERER = "pixman";
+ };
+
+ # To help with OCR:
+ etc."xdg/foot/foot.ini".text = lib.generators.toINI { } {
+ main = {
+ font = "inconsolata:size=14";
+ };
+ colors = rec {
+ foreground = "000000";
+ background = "ffffff";
+ regular2 = foreground;
+ };
+ };
+ };
+
+ fonts.packages = [ pkgs.inconsolata ];
+
+ # Automatically configure and start Sway when logging in on tty1:
+ programs.bash.loginShellInit = ''
+ if [ "$(tty)" = "/dev/tty1" ]; then
+ set -e
+
+ mkdir -p ~/.config/sway
+ sed s/Mod4/Mod1/ /etc/sway/config > ~/.config/sway/config
+
+ sway --validate
+ sway && touch /tmp/sway-exit-ok
+ fi
+ '';
+
+ programs.sway.enable = true;
+
+ # Need to switch to a different GPU driver than the default one (-vga std) so that Sway can launch:
+ virtualisation.qemu.options = [ "-vga none -device virtio-gpu-pci" ];
+
+ environment.fortify = {
+ enable = true;
+ stateDir = "/var/lib/fortify";
+ users.alice = 0;
+ };
+
+ imports = [
+ self.nixosModules.fortify
+ home-manager.nixosModules.home-manager
+ ];
+ };
+
+ testScript = ''
+ import shlex
+ import json
+
+ q = shlex.quote
+ NODE_GROUPS = ["nodes", "floating_nodes"]
+
+
+ def swaymsg(command: str = "", succeed=True, type="command"):
+ assert command != "" or type != "command", "Must specify command or type"
+ shell = q(f"swaymsg -t {q(type)} -- {q(command)}")
+ with machine.nested(
+ f"sending swaymsg {shell!r}" + " (allowed to fail)" * (not succeed)
+ ):
+ ret = (machine.succeed if succeed else machine.execute)(
+ f"su - alice -c {shell}"
+ )
+
+ # execute also returns a status code, but disregard.
+ if not succeed:
+ _, ret = ret
+
+ if not succeed and not ret:
+ return None
+
+ parsed = json.loads(ret)
+ return parsed
+
+
+ def walk(tree):
+ yield tree
+ for group in NODE_GROUPS:
+ for node in tree.get(group, []):
+ yield from walk(node)
+
+
+ def wait_for_window(pattern):
+ def func(last_chance):
+ nodes = (node["name"] for node in walk(swaymsg(type="get_tree")))
+
+ if last_chance:
+ nodes = list(nodes)
+ machine.log(f"Last call! Current list of windows: {nodes}")
+
+ return any(pattern in name for name in nodes)
+
+ retry(func)
+
+ start_all()
+ machine.wait_for_unit("multi-user.target")
+
+ # To check the version:
+ print(machine.succeed("sway --version"))
+
+ # Wait for Sway to complete startup:
+ machine.wait_for_file("/run/user/1000/wayland-1")
+ machine.wait_for_file("/tmp/sway-ipc.sock")
+
+ # Create fortify aid 0 home directory:
+ machine.succeed("install -dm 0700 -o 1000000 -g 1000000 /var/lib/fortify/u0/a0")
+
+ # Start fortify outside Wayland session:
+ print(machine.succeed("sudo -u alice -i fortify -v run -a 0 touch /tmp/success-bare"))
+ machine.wait_for_file("/tmp/fortify.1000/tmpdir/0/success-bare")
+
+ # Start fortify within Wayland session:
+ swaymsg("exec fortify -v run --wayland touch /tmp/success-session")
+ machine.wait_for_file("/tmp/fortify.1000/tmpdir/0/success-session")
+
+ # Start a terminal (foot) within fortify on workspace 3:
+ machine.send_key("alt-3")
+ machine.sleep(3)
+ swaymsg("exec fortify run --wayland foot")
+ wait_for_window("u0_a0@machine")
+ machine.send_chars("touch /tmp/success-client\n")
+ machine.wait_for_file("/tmp/fortify.1000/tmpdir/0/success-client")
+ machine.screenshot("foot_wayland_permissive")
+ machine.send_chars("exit\n")
+ machine.wait_until_fails("pgrep foot")
+
+ # Start a terminal (foot) within fortify from a terminal on workspace 4:
+ machine.send_key("alt-4")
+ machine.sleep(3)
+ swaymsg("exec foot fortify run --wayland foot")
+ wait_for_window("u0_a0@machine")
+ machine.send_chars("touch /tmp/success-client-term\n")
+ machine.wait_for_file("/tmp/fortify.1000/tmpdir/0/success-client-term")
+ machine.screenshot("foot_wayland_permissive_term")
+ machine.send_chars("exit\n")
+ machine.wait_until_fails("pgrep foot")
+
+ # Exit Sway and verify process exit status 0:
+ swaymsg("exit", succeed=False)
+ machine.wait_until_fails("pgrep -x sway")
+ machine.wait_for_file("/tmp/sway-exit-ok")
+ '';
+}
